Ask and you shall recieve....


New Santana Moss isn't really new at all...Same guy...better Qb and OC. The Jets had a OC who never went deep and didn't utilize moss at all. No wonder the kid ran for the sideline...He's not built for over the middle routes...So instead of calling plays to suit his skills,they wasted his talents.

The Jets are very aware how bad Chad Pennington sucks ...They also know how Coles skills suit Chad Penningtons weak arm.

Both teams got the better WR for their team. Our QB just sucks something awful and now the Jets have a walking corpse playing Qb.

Moss on the other hand is flourishing in his new offense and with his new QB. The OC here has balls going deep this much but Moss can do it.

Sideline Santana Moss got a chance for a fresh start...Im glad to see him taking advantage of it.

I was wrong...it wasn't Moss...It was Chad Pennington & Paul Hackett.
